The magnet approach may work for you: I am trying to convert some PoserWorld V3 Male shirts back to Female. I can do this with Tailor, but I'm not happy with the results -- the breasts are to bubbly and exaggerated and the lower back does not fit quite right. I downladed and installed SpectreWare's Ultimate Breast Magnet Pack 3(free). I loaded and conformed V3 and the shirt, then I applied "Vicky Full v05". I kept tweaking until I got the shape I wanted. The results are far better than what I got with Tailor, as magnets give you much more control over the shape. More importantly, I learned how to use magnets.
